function persistStream(source: ReadableStream<Uint8Array>, messageId: string) {
  const transform = new TransformStream<Uint8Array, Uint8Array>();
  const decoder = new TextDecoder();
  let content = "";

  void source
    .pipeThrough(
      new TransformStream({
        transform(chunk, controller) {
          content += decoder.decode(chunk, { stream: true });
          controller.enqueue(chunk);
        },
        flush() {
          content += decoder.decode();
        },
      }),
    )
    .pipeTo(transform.writable)
    .then(() => updateMessage(getPool(), messageId, content, "complete"))
    .catch(() => updateMessage(getPool(), messageId, content, "stopped"));

  return transform.readable;
}
